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our technicians will conduct a thorough assessment of your home to identify the source and extent of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the structural integrity of your walls.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Once we’ve identified the affected areas, our team will use powerful extraction equipment to remove the water from your wall cavities.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to reduce disruption and pr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from your walls. We’ll also use dehumidifiers to prevent m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Finally, our technicians will clean and sanitize your walls to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products that are safe for your family and pets.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Once your walls are clean and dry, our team will repair any damaged areas, including drywall, plaster, and insulation. We’ll work with you to select the best materials and finishes to match your home’s original style and design.

Wall Cavity Water Extraction Cost in Cooleemee, NC
The cost of Wall Cavity Water Extraction in Cooleemee, NC can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our prices start at around $500 for small jobs and can go up to $2,500 or more for larger jobs. The cost will depend on the amount of water damage, the number of wall cavities affected, and the type of materials used for the repair.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Small leak repair |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ials used |
| Large flood cleanup | $1,000 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of materials used, amount of water damage |
| Hidden moisture detection |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Water damage repair |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ials used, amount of water damage |
| Mold and mildew removal |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, amount of mold and mildew |
